Decoding Your 1982 Yamaha Xt200 Wiring Diagram

At its core, a wiring diagram is a schematic representation of the electrical pathways within a vehicle. For your 1982 Yamaha Xt200, this means it shows how the battery connects to the ignition system, lights, turn signals, horn, and any other electrical accessory. It uses standardized symbols to represent different electrical components, such as wires, switches, fuses, bulbs, and more. Familiarizing yourself with these symbols is the first step to effectively using the diagram. Having a clear understanding of the wiring diagram is essential for any electrical repair or modification.

The primary use of the 1982 Yamaha Xt200 Wiring Diagram is troubleshooting. When a light doesn't work, the engine won't spark, or a component malfunctions, the diagram helps you trace the flow of electricity. You can follow the wires from the power source (usually the battery) through various switches and components to identify where the circuit is broken or shorted. This systematic approach is far more efficient than randomly checking parts. Here's a simplified look at what you might find:

Beyond troubleshooting, the 1982 Yamaha Xt200 Wiring Diagram is invaluable for maintenance and upgrades. If you're replacing a switch, installing a new headlight, or adding aftermarket accessories, the diagram provides the correct connection points and wire colors. This helps ensure that everything is wired correctly and safely, preventing damage to the electrical system or the new components. For instance, if you're planning to install auxiliary lights, the diagram will guide you on where to tap into the bike's power and how to route the wiring.
